What are concrete pavers and porcelain pavers? 

  • Concrete pavers, are constructed of concrete and sand, and they harden naturally once molded into shape.
  • Porcelain pavers on the other hand,  are created by combining clay, sand, and other ingredients, then baking them to achieve their final shape. 

Concrete pavers are less expensive and more durable than porcelain pavers, making them a better option for consumers looking to save money on premium pavers for their outdoor. They’re also relatively simple to build and install, making them a popular choice for homeowners.

How do concrete pavers and porcelain tiles perform in extreme weather conditions?

This is where concrete pavers really shine, and it’s something most comparison articles completely ignore. While porcelain tiles look impressive in controlled environments, they face serious challenges when mother nature decides to test them. 

  • Freezing and heating cycles are harsh on any outdoor material, but concrete pavers withstand them better than many people assume. 

Quality outdoor concrete tiles use precise aggregate mixtures that allow for thermal expansion without cracking. They are permeable enough to minimize water collection while remaining strong enough to withstand freezing damage.

  • Heat performance is another area where concrete takes the lead. 

In regions with intense summer sun, porcelain tiles can become uncomfortably hot to walk on barefoot. Some types actually retain heat well into the evening hours. Concrete pavers, especially lighter colored varieties, reflect more heat and cool down faster as temperatures drop.

  • The true issue is how it hits resistance.

 Placing a large planter on porcelain paver will most likely result in breaking. Concrete pavers can withstand the same force without any damage. This is more important than most homeowners believe

  • Rain performance deserves special mention too. 

Many concrete paver systems are designed as permeable concrete pavers, allowing water to drain through the joints and reduce runoff issues. This not only prevents standing water but can actually help with local drainage problems that plague many outdoors.

What maintenance differences should you expect with concrete pavers vs porcelain tiles?

Maintenance is where many homeowners get surprised, and it’s an area where concrete pavers offer significant advantages that most comparison guides completely miss.

  • Cleaning concrete pavers is straightforward and uses common household products. A pressure washer, and occasional sand replacement in joints handles most maintenance needs. After a few years, restoration and resurfacing by Ducon can make it look just like new. 
  • Porcelain tiles sound low-maintenance in theory, but the reality is more complex. While the surface resists staining, the grout lines between tiles become magnets for dirt, algae, and discoloration. Cleaning grout effectively requires specific products and techniques, and even then, it often needs periodic professional cleaning to maintain its appearance.
  • Joint maintenance reveals another concrete advantage.

Sand joints in concrete paver installations are meant to be maintained and refreshed periodically. This isn’t a design flaw, it’s a feature. Fresh joint sand keeps the installation stable while allowing for easy adjustments if settling occurs.

  • Porcelain tile grout, once it starts failing, requires complete removal and replacement. This is a process that often disturbs surrounding tiles.

Which material handles heavy loads better: concrete pavers vs porcelain tiles?

When it comes to load-bearing capacity, concrete pavers demonstrate clear superiority, especially in applications that go beyond basic foot traffic. This is crucial information that most comparison articles ignore completely.

  • Heavy-duty paver installation using concrete can easily handle vehicle traffic, delivery trucks, and even emergency vehicle access when properly installed. 
  • Many driveway paving stones are specifically designed for vehicle loads, with high compressive strengths. This makes them suitable for driveways, commercial applications, and high-traffic areas.
  • Porcelain tiles, despite their hardness, are fundamentally breakable materials. They can handle distributed loads reasonably well, but point loads or impact forces often cause cracking or chipping. This limitation makes them less suitable for areas where heavy objects might be dropped or wheeled across the surface.

Are there design differences between the Concrete and Porcelain Pavers ?

Both concrete and porcelain pavers provide a diverse range of design options in terms of color, form, and pattern. Some may prefer the natural stone look commonly attained with porcelain pavers, but concrete pavers can replicate a range of materials, including brick and genuine stone.

Can both concrete and porcelain types of pavers be utilized in different outdoor applications?

Yes, however most concrete pavers are suitable for a variety of outside applications, including patios, walks, driveways, and pool decks. The choice, however, may be determined by individual project requirements and aesthetic preferences.
